首先,我们需要在pom.xml文件中添加tabula的依赖: <dependency><groupId>technology.tabula</groupId><artifactId>tabula-java</artifactId><version>1.0.3</version></dependency> 1. 2. 3. 4. 5. 接下来,我们将通过一个代码示例来演示如何使用tabula提取PDF中的表格数据。假设我们有一个名为“example.pdf”的...
从https://github.com/tabulapdf/tabula-java下载tabula-java-master.zip,使用Eclipse将tabula打成jar包,然后将jar引用到自己的工程中。也可以直接下载tabula-1.0.2-jar-with-dependencies.jar到本地。 1.2 获取Windows客户端工具 从https://tabula.technology下载tabula-win-1.2.0.zip到本地,解压后运行tabula.exe即...
因为上面有 for (int i = 0; i < calculation.size(); i++)循环,当你执行 calculation.remove(i);之后,i所指向的已经是下一个符号或者是数字了,但因为for循环仍然需要i++,故要提前把i-1。 此处与栈的操作类型有几分相似之处,再MyDC.java中,经过 while (tokenizer.hasMoreTokens()) //进行遍历 { to...
word文件看起来很复杂,不方便结构化。事实上,word文档中大概有几种内容:paragraph(段落)、table(表格)...
在Java中使用tabula提取PDF中的表格数据 在Java中使⽤tabula提取PDF中的表格数据问题:如何将pdf⽂件中指定的表格数据提取出来?尝试过的⼯具包有:pdfbox、tabula。最终选⽤tabula 两种⼯具的⽐较 pdfbox 其中,pdfbox能将pdf中的内容直接提取成String,代码⽚段:public static void readPdf(String path...
在使用Tabula库读取PDF文件时,出现“java not found”错误,通常是因为系统中没有安装Java或者Java环境变量未正确配置。 基础概念 Tabula 是一个用于从PDF文件中提取表格数据的工具,它依赖于Java运行环境(JRE)来执行其功能。 Java 是一种广泛使用的编程语言和平台,许多工具和应用程序依赖Java运行。 相关...
java tabula使用 java.util.Calendar Calendar,翻译过来是日历。它的作用是将日期按照年、月、日、小时、分钟、秒、星期几等等生活常用的日期数据的方式保存起来。这样,程序员就可以直接获得一个日期的很多数据,同时我们也可以对其中的某一项进行修改,Calendar会自动修改其他的数值,就比如说:如果一个Calendar,分钟是59,...
51CTO博客已为您找到关于Tabula java 使用的相关内容,包含IT学习相关文档代码介绍、相关教程视频课程,以及Tabula java 使用问答内容。更多Tabula java 使用相关解答可以来51CTO博客参与分享和学习,帮助广大IT技术人实现成长和进步。
用Python提取PDF文件表格中的数据,这里我说的是,只提取PDF文件中表格中的数据,其他数据不提取。这样的...
经过Google发现有py2exe和Pyinstaller可以将Python脚本编译成Windows(Pyinstaller支持多平台)可执行文件。经...